Combining Microsoft Business Intelligence with the Teradata Warehouse
Date: December 13, 2007
Register
If you have, or are planning to install, a Teradata Warehouse, and you want to provide almost everyone in your organization with access to information to support their decisions, you are undoubtedly asking yourself several questions. Since you have established the business need for BI, your first question is probably: 'Can I utilize tools I already own and my people already know how to use, such as Microsoft Excel and the Web?Once you know this is possible, your next line of thought will revolve around: How do I optimize the Microsoft and Teradata tools to work together?
Once you have this foundation in place, youll be asking:How can I surface information throughout my organization, from the loading dock to the executive suite, to optimize the workflow of my people?
This seminar answers the above questions, and digs into some of the details of Microsofts Office PerformancePoint 2007 technologies, as well as discussing how to architect a solution that leverages the power of your Teradata Warehouse, to ensure access to all of your enterprise data with a high speed of response and optimal total cost of ownership.
Youll also hear an update on the Microsoft-Teradata partnership and what is coming down the pipe.
